Страница 1 из 1
Yii2 на digitalocean
Добавлено: 2015.01.26, 22:10
S c
Код: Выделить всё
server {
charset utf-8;
client_max_body_size 128M;
listen 80; ## listen for ipv4
server_name localhost;
root /home/demo/public_html/test/public/frontend/web;
index index.php;
access_log /home/demo/public_html/test/log/access.log;
error_log /home/demo/public_html/test/log/error.log;
location / {
# Redirect everything that isn't a real file to index.php
try_files $uri $uri/ /index.php?$args;
}
location ~ \.php$ {
include fastcgi_params;
fastcgi_pass unix:/var/run/php5-fpm.sock;
try_files $uri =404;
}
location ~ /\.(ht|svn|git) {
deny all;
}
}
это содержимое файла /etc/nginx/sites-available/test (+ сделал линк /etc/nginx/sites-enabled/test)
В файле /etc/nginx/sites-available/default поменял
Перезагрузил nginx, открываю сайт (по IP) - а открывается дефалтное "Welcome to nginx!". Причем такая процедура на локальной убунте работает отлично. На digitalocean (ubuntu 14.04 + lemp) - не прокатывает. Что я не так делаю?
Re: Yii2 на digitalocean
Добавлено: 2015.01.26, 22:28
lynicidn
конфиг lemp перепутал с lamp и тем более с nginx ?
Re: Yii2 на digitalocean
Добавлено: 2015.01.26, 22:28
lynicidn
зачем default менять если ты конфигурируешь в test ?
Re: Yii2 на digitalocean
Добавлено: 2015.01.26, 22:28
lynicidn
/etc/hosts ты правил?
панель юзаешь?
Re: Yii2 на digitalocean
Добавлено: 2015.01.26, 22:32
S c
1) причем тут lamp и nginx? nginx входит в lemp сборку.
2) default поменял т.к. первая мысль у меня была о том, что test ссылается на localhost (server_name) и default тоже. Типа из default брало путь. Вообщем это был шаг отчаяния)
3) hosts то правил. Правда там и править нечего, localhost итак вписан.
4) Про панель поточнее плз
Re: Yii2 на digitalocean
Добавлено: 2015.01.26, 22:37
lynicidn
1. что такое lemp ?
2. default надо удалить или править в нем, если 1 домен привязан
3. в хостс надо прописать
111.111.111.111 domain.com
но домен должен быть проделигирован, и в днс создана запись А соответствующая
4. панель наверное не стои
Re: Yii2 на digitalocean
Добавлено: 2015.01.26, 22:38
lynicidn
стукни в скайп помогу поднять - lynicidn
Re: Yii2 на digitalocean
Добавлено: 2015.01.27, 00:09
S c
Огромное спасибо lynicidn за помощь.
Re: Yii2 на digitalocean
Добавлено: 2015.01.27, 16:15
S c
Теперь еще вопрос - есть ли смысл ставить панель управления хостингом? Типа vesta, cpane, plesk и пр.? Или правильне будет научиться конфигурировать все ручками?
Re: Yii2 на digitalocean
Добавлено: 2015.01.27, 16:40
valentinich
Лично я, как программист php, не вижу смысла перечитывать маны, как устаналивать задачи по крону, либо работать с бэкапами, либо создавать пользователей ftp и тд. через консоль, поэтому использую весту.
Re: Yii2 на digitalocean
Добавлено: 2015.01.27, 16:45
lynicidn
панель зло
Re: Yii2 на digitalocean
Добавлено: 2018.01.31, 14:59
olidev
Почему вы пытаетесь развернуть приложение Yii вручную на digitalocean? Этот метод потребует много времени и усилий. Для быстрого развертывания вы можете использовать инструмент, например Ansible или платформу, например Cloudways Yii. Эта платформа предоставит предварительно настроенный сервер. Вам нужно будет только установить Yii2 через команду композитора.
Re: Yii2 на digitalocean
Добавлено: 2018.01.31, 15:17
S c
тема 3х летней давности)
сейчас и сам yii на DI очень быстро можно развернуть с закрытыми глазами
Re: Yii2 на digitalocean
Добавлено: 2018.01.31, 15:24
zelenin
olidev писал(а): ↑2018.01.31, 14:59
Почему вы пытаетесь развернуть приложение Yii вручную на digitalocean? Этот метод потребует много времени и усилий.
конечно нет
Re: Yii2 на digitalocean
Добавлено: 2018.01.31, 15:30
S c
это реклама в общем)